How to speak: Talk live, Tap to talk, Review & send

Choose a speaking method. Start a session before you speak.

student

Audience: Students · Applies to: SaaS / private (same speaking stage in Oral embed)

The three options decide how you speak, not what you practice. Only one is active at a time.

On the speaking stage the default method is Tap to talk. Settings may still label the same option Hold to talk.

Start the session first

For most practice, tap Start session before you speak. The idle hint says you can practice after starting the session. When you finish, tap End session to see the review. You can Pause / Resume during the session.

Choose a method

MethodActionBest for
Tap to talkTap to start recording; tap Done in the voice panel to sendMost practice; simple and reliable
Review & sendSpeak or type, check the text, then submitEditing your wording, weak networks, or limited microphone use
Talk liveTap Start talking and speak continuouslyFast reactions and natural conversation

For your first practice, start with Tap to talk.

Talk live

  1. Select Talk live.
  2. Tap Start session if it is shown.
  3. Select Start talking and allow microphone access.
  4. Speak naturally while AI listens and replies.
  5. Select End conversation, then End session if needed.

Notes:

  • The speaking method is locked while the conversation is active.
  • Changing the practice mode or scenario automatically ends the current conversation before loading the new content.
  • If Talk live is loading, unavailable, or busy, use Tap to talk.
  • Some pages, including exams, may not offer Talk live.

Tap to talk

  1. Select Tap to talk.
  2. Tap Start session.
  3. Tap the button and speak.
  4. Tap Done in the voice panel to send.

Use this when you want to practice one turn at a time without editing the text first.

Review & send

  1. Select Review & send.
  2. Tap Start session.
  3. Fill the text by voice or type it.
  4. Check and edit the text.
  5. Submit it.

Use this when wording and speech-recognition accuracy matter.
